Add a type cast and use extract64() instead of extract32()
to avoid integer overflow on addition. Fix bit fields
extraction according to documentation.

Found by Linux Verification Center (linuxtesting.org) with SVACE.

Fixes: d3c6369a96 ("introduce xlnx-dpdma")
Signed-off-by: Alexandra Diupina <adiupina@astralinux.ru>
---
v2: fix typo
 hw/dma/xlnx_dpdma.c | 20 ++++++++++----------
 1 file changed, 10 insertions(+), 10 deletions(-)

diff --git a/hw/dma/xlnx_dpdma.c b/hw/dma/xlnx_dpdma.c
index 1f5cd64ed1..530717d188 100644
--- a/hw/dma/xlnx_dpdma.c
+++ b/hw/dma/xlnx_dpdma.c
@@ -175,24 +175,24 @@ static uint64_t xlnx_dpdma_desc_get_source_address(DPDMADescriptor *desc,
 
     switch (frag) {
     case 0:
-        addr = desc->source_address
-            + (extract32(desc->address_extension, 16, 12) << 20);
+        addr = (uint64_t)desc->source_address
+            + (extract64(desc->address_extension, 16, 16) << 32);
         break;
     case 1:
-        addr = desc->source_address2
-            + (extract32(desc->address_extension_23, 0, 12) << 8);
+        addr = (uint64_t)desc->source_address2
+            + (extract64(desc->address_extension_23, 0, 16) << 32);
         break;
     case 2:
-        addr = desc->source_address3
-            + (extract32(desc->address_extension_23, 16, 12) << 20);
+        addr = (uint64_t)desc->source_address3
+            + (extract64(desc->address_extension_23, 16, 16) << 32);
         break;
     case 3:
-        addr = desc->source_address4
-            + (extract32(desc->address_extension_45, 0, 12) << 8);
+        addr = (uint64_t)desc->source_address4
+            + (extract64(desc->address_extension_45, 0, 16) << 32);
         break;
     case 4:
-        addr = desc->source_address5
-            + (extract32(desc->address_extension_45, 16, 12) << 20);
+        addr = (uint64_t)desc->source_address5
+            + (extract64(desc->address_extension_45, 16, 16) << 32);
         break;
     default:
         addr = 0;
